InOrbit.AI ships OpenRobOps, first ISO 21423 reference implementation

3 Key Points

  1. What happened

    InOrbit.AI released OpenRobOps, an Apache 2.0 open-source robot fleet operations foundation it calls the industry's first ISO 21423 reference implementation.

  2. Why it matters

    OEMs previously spent years building custom back ends and user interfaces; InOrbit says OpenRobOps lets teams bypass years of back-end development.

  3. What to watch

    The test is whether OEMs adopt ORO instead of building their own fleet managers, since InOrbit's paid Space Intelligence remains separate.

WHO IT HITSRobotics developers at OEMs and startups building autonomous mobile robot fleets can adopt a ready-made operations layer instead of writing their own back ends. Academic researchers benefit too, since the Apache 2.0 license allows free adaptation and deployment.

Context & Analysis

OpenRobOps traces its roots to a February announcement by InOrbit, which has now followed through with a full release. The company frames the timing around a familiar problem: as fleets of autonomous mobile robots grow, customers expect OEMs to ship full-featured fleet managers, but many OEMs instead spend years maintaining custom back ends and interfaces rather than refining their robots. InOrbit calls this the "build trap" and positions OpenRobOps as an escape.

The release also carries a standards angle. ISO 21423 is still upcoming, yet OpenRobOps already includes a reference implementation, and InOrbit's CEO sits on the ISO working group as an ANSI representative. InOrbit points to a public demonstration of ISO 21423 at Automate 2026, where 10 companies showed multi-vendor orchestration based on the company's paid Space Intelligence product, as evidence the approach works in practice.

The stakes likely hinge on adoption. InOrbit compares OpenRobOps to ROS, which saved roboticists from rewriting low-level device drivers; whether OEMs treat ORO the same way, rather than continuing to build their own back ends, is the open question. For end users, the benefit may depend on how broadly ISO 21423 compliance spreads across vendors.

FAQ
What license is OpenRobOps released under?
It is distributed under the Apache 2.0 license, allowing academic researchers, robotics startups, and commercial enterprises to adapt, embed, and deploy it without licensing fees.
What is ISO 21423?
It is an upcoming interoperability standard from the International Organization for Standardization that establishes communication and data exchange rules for industrial mobile robots and fleet managers.
Does OpenRobOps work with any type of robot?
Yes. CEO Florian Pestoni said it applies to any robot regardless of form factor, including wheeled, two-legged, or four-legged designs.
